Skip to main content

A package for socket/serial data plotting

Project description

LuIsabel

Plotting tool based on the arduino plotter using python and Qt, with extended functionality.

Here a little Demo: Luisabel small Demo

Dependencies

  • Python 3.9(!)
  • Pyserial: pip install pyserial
  • PyQt5: pip install PyQt5
  • numpy: pip install numpy
  • pyqtgraph: pip install pyqtgraph
  • Qt Widgets: pip install qtwidgets
  • To simplify (in the project folder): pip install -r requirements.txt
  • submodules: git submodule update --init --recursive

Many thanks to:

  • Qt Development team: Is such a great tool!
  • Developers who ported QT5 to python : Even better when it's so easy to develop!
  • PyqtGraph Developers: This tool wouldn't have been possible without his fantastic pyqtgraph library.
  • Martin Fitzpatrick: For writing qtwidgets, and also for his book about PyQt5.
  • Yusuke Kamiyamane: For the icons.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

luisabel_serial_plotter-0.1.3.tar.gz (54.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

luisabel_serial_plotter-0.1.3-py3-none-any.whl (63.7 kB view details)

Uploaded Python 3

File details

Details for the file luisabel_serial_plotter-0.1.3.tar.gz.

File metadata

  • Download URL: luisabel_serial_plotter-0.1.3.tar.gz
  • Upload date:
  • Size: 54.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.4

File hashes

Hashes for luisabel_serial_plotter-0.1.3.tar.gz
Algorithm Hash digest
SHA256 242006b8a7a9b2acd314e15e32ddb2bd2bb2f34a2881856be0c4cd55ffea0e1e
MD5 ea08e109d930954be7f2a27cd2e12798
BLAKE2b-256 216a3689664eb406d84ca67338ce18926817a4767849dc92a00c6f9603de7aaf

See more details on using hashes here.

File details

Details for the file luisabel_serial_plotter-0.1.3-py3-none-any.whl.

File metadata

File hashes

Hashes for luisabel_serial_plotter-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 3b6de8c6ae414ad2892b8a2c339b30394d1a70d99eee5967c3a5601f479b0bf4
MD5 dcc873cb8cbfca0a17861f6b1d2cb72c
BLAKE2b-256 79e5a4deea360771dc943a9b5f16a5d71e79d9f9491b358022ca62f83c69cbd2

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page